To maintain accuracy while short passing, kick the ball using the inside of the foot. When long passing, use the front of the foot where the laces on the shoes are. Such kicking lets you use more power to get the ball farther.

The Outside Elastico is a simple beginner move. It is great for when you are positioned on the flanks and need to cut inside. Practice this by placing a shoe, bag or cone on the ground. You want to be a good five steps or so back from the object on the ground. Start dribbling in that direction. Once you come near the cone, touch the ball on the outside and then inside as quickly as possible. Fooling your opponent occurs through the outside touch. Remember, the second touch should be stronger than the first one.

Come up with a strategy with your teammates. Let them know when you intent on crossing the ball, enabling them the opportunity to position themselves to receive it. Consider establishing a pattern within the team of crossing the ball in a specific direction at certain times, then switching to the other side.
